Aparadhini Yesayya Lyrics in Telugu & English – Sirivarapu Krupanandam

Aparadhini Yesayya lyrics express deep repentance and a heartfelt plea for forgiveness before Jesus Christ. This Telugu Christian worship song was written by Sirivarapu Krupanandam (also known as Siripurapu Krupaanandamu) and is widely sung in churches during prayer and confession services.

Aparadhini Yesayya Song Lyrics in Telugu

అపరాధిని యేసయ్యా
కృపజూపి బ్రోవుమయ్యా (2)
నెపమెంచకయె నీ కృపలో
నపరాధములను క్షమించు (2)

సిలువకు నిను నే గొట్టి
తులువలతో జేరితిని (2)
కలుషంబులను మోపితిని
దోషుండ నేను ప్రభువా (2)

ప్రక్కలో బల్లెపుపోటు
గ్రక్కున పొడిచితి నేనే (2)
మిక్కిలి బాధించితిని
మక్కువ జూపితి వయ్యో (2)

ముళ్ళతో కిరీటంబు
నల్లి నీ శిరమున నిడితి (2)
నా వల్ల నేరమాయె
చల్లని దయగల తండ్రి (2)

దాహంబు గొనగా చేదు
చిరకను ద్రావ నిడితి (2)
ద్రోహుండనై జేసితినీ
దేహంబు గాయంబులను (2)

ఘోరంబుగా దూరితిని
నేరంబులను జేసితిని (2)
కౄరుండనై గొట్టితిని
ఘోరంపు పాపిని దేవా (2)

చిందితి రక్తము నాకై
పొందిన దెబ్బల చేత (2)
అపనిందలు మోపితినయ్యో
సందేహమేలనయ్యా (2)

శిక్షకు పాత్రుడనయ్యా
రక్షణ దెచ్చితివయ్యా (2)
అక్షయ భాగ్యము నియ్య
మోక్షంబు జూపితివయ్యా (2)

Meaning of Aparadhini Yesayya

“Aparadhini Yesayya,” written by Sirivarapu Krupanandam, is a Telugu Christian devotional hymn of repentance. The word “Aparadhini” means sinner or offender. The lyrics express a believer’s humble confession before Jesus Christ, acknowledging personal sins and seeking forgiveness through His mercy and sacrificial love on the cross. The song reflects themes of grace, redemption, and salvation through Christ.

Biblical Inspiration

The message of this song reflects Psalm 51, where David prays for mercy and cleansing from sin. It also aligns with 1 John 1:9, which promises forgiveness to those who confess their sins.
